OM Girls Win HoCo Indoor Track Championships

Tue, 01/30/2024 - 11:09am


The Boys and Girls Indoor track teams had strong showings at the Howard County Championships on Monday, January 29, 2024.

The OM girls WON first place over Howard to capture their first Indoor County Title in over 10 years. The girls were led by Junior Alicia Hall who broke the School, Meet and COUNTY record in the Triple Jump with a leap of 39-00. That is the best jump in Maryland and the 20th-best jump in the COUNTRY. She also placed 3rd in the Long and High Jump and 7th in the Shot Put. Shania Staats also had herself a night breaking the School, County, and Meet record in the Long Jump with a leap of 18-4 inches. She also placed 3rd in the 55-meter dash and 4th in the Triple Jump. Valerie Ashamu won the girls' High Jump and placed 7th in the 300-meter dash. Frankie Moore placed 2nd in the 1600 with a new lifetime Personal Best of 5:13, 3rd in the 3200, and 5th in the 800. She went on to anchor the 1st place 4x400 relay team with Janelle Codrington, Fisayo Sule, and Mackenzie Smith. 

The boys placed 2nd to Howard and were led by Adeeb Pender who placed 1st in the Pole Vault, Keshon Tate who placed 2nd in the Long Jump, Jayden Deleon who placed 2nd in the 300, Isaac Ramsey who placed 3rd in the 55 Hurdles, Kaiden Lee who placed 3rd in the Shot Put and AJ York who placed 3rd in the High Jump. The highlight of the night on the boys' side was the Boys 4x800 relay of Folu Longe, Mark Small, Shamar Johnson, and Ja White placing 1st and breaking the School Record!

There were many other great performances and personal bests. The Indoor Track team is back in action next week at the 3A South Regionals.
